Compact museum famed for the world’s largest tile collection. It explains azulejo art and includes a beautiful church interior.
Museum built around Gulbenkian’s exceptional private collection, from ancient artifacts to European masters, in a calm garden setting.
Lisbon’s oldest district, with narrow lanes, viewpoints, and fado heritage. It is the city’s most atmospheric area for wandering on foot.
Elegant central square on the Tagus framed by arcades and grand façades. A key meeting point and one of Lisbon’s defining public spaces.
Grand square famous for wave-pattern paving, fountains, and surrounding architecture. It is a classic starting point for central Lisbon walks.
Salt cod baked with cream, onion and potatoes. A beloved Lisbon comfort dish showing Portugal's deep bacalhau tradition.
Grilled salted cod, usually served with potatoes, olive oil and greens. Simple, iconic and central to Portuguese home cooking.
Shredded salted cod sautéed with onions, straw fries and egg. A classic Lisbon recipe said to have originated in the city.

Moderate for Western Europe: lodging is cheaper than Paris, but central hotels rise in peak season. Meals and transit are generally good value for tourists.
Service is usually included. Round up or leave 5-10% in restaurants for good service; small change for cafes; taxi tips are optional, usually rounding up.
